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60073851087 111015729 649879 83901763 6144583
1287477049 58052258 277
1287477049 58052258 277
46109 94960615 9975
All about undefined
Interested in learning more?
1287477049 58052258 277
46109 94960615 9975
See more
48776801 945530 94907289
4335170 860508 083264903
See more
701813 417816
0511 33495 489 60343
See more